Output 7ae19c124fc43179b14cab5801acce63da3a850664ee3e49058320e14fb44b2d:156

value
73066
script pubkey
OP_0 OP_PUSHBYTES_20 cf5b903d8aaf7bd8219fa515ed017a0fcf10ef6f
address
bc1qeadeq0v24aaasgvl55276qt6pl83pmm0jgxe3c
transaction
7ae19c124fc43179b14cab5801acce63da3a850664ee3e49058320e14fb44b2d
confirmations
127259
spent
true